Things will be a bit different when the General Assembly returns to the Statehouse for its fall veto session in October. The weather will be cooler. The days will be shorter. And for the first time in more than 20 years, Kirk W. Dillard will not be a state senator. The Hinsdale Republican and two-time candidate for governor officially stepped down this month to become chairman of the Regional Transportation Authority.
